#2F7059 Hex Color Code

#2F7059

The Hexadecimal Color #2F7059 is a contrast shade of Sea Green. #2F7059 RGB value is rgb(47, 112, 89). RGB Color Model of #2F7059 consists of 18% red, 43% green and 34% blue. HSL color Mode of #2F7059 has 159°(degrees) Hue, 41% Saturation and 31% Lightness. #2F7059 color has an wavelength of 519.88889n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#2F7059 is #339966.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#2F7059 is #375. The Closest Color to #2F7059 is #2E8B57. Official Name of #2F7059 Hex Code is Amazon.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#2F7059 is 58 Cyan 0 Magenta 21 Yellow 56 Black and #2F7059 CMY is 58, 0, 21.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#2F7059 is hsl(159,41,31,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(159, 58, 44).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#2F7059 is 8.77, 12.91, 11.48.
Hex8 Value of #2F7059 is #2F7059FF. Decimal Value of #2F7059 is 3108953 and Octal Value of #2F7059 is 13670131. Binary Value of #2F7059 is 101111, 1110000, 1011001 and Android of #2F7059 is 4281299033 / 0xff2f7059.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#2F7059 is 0.264, 0.389, 0.389 and YIQ Color Space of #2F7059 is 89.943, -31.3436, -20.9051.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#2F7059 is 10.11, 15.81, 11.49.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#2F7059 is 42.63, -26.77, 6.6.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#2F7059 is 42.63, -27.56, 12.3.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#2F7059 is 42.63, 27.57, 166.15. Hunter Lab variable of #2F7059 is 35.93, -19.31, 6.21.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#2F7059

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
